Neodium Terminal Music Player

This is a terminal based music player that uses YouTube APIs and PyTube to work! This Python script allows you to search for a song on YouTube, download its audio, add it to a playlist, and play it using the playsound library.

Prerequisites

  • Python 3.x
  • google-api-python-client library
  • pytube library
  • playsound library

Setup

Install the required Python libraries using pip:

pip install google-api-python-client pytube playsound
  • Obtain a YouTube Data API key from the Google Developers Console.
  • Set up the YouTube Data API by enabling it for your project and creating an API key.

Usage

  • Run the script main.py using Python.
  • Enter the name of the song you want to download. Make sure to include the artist's name for better search results.
  • The script will search for the song on YouTube, download its audio, save it to a 'music' folder, and play it using the playsound library.
  • You will be prompted to add the downloaded song to a playlist.

Optionally, you can choose to play the entire playlist once the download is complete.

Features

  • Searches for songs on YouTube using the YouTube Data API.
  • Downloads the audio of the selected song.
  • Saves downloaded songs to a 'music' folder.
  • Adds songs to a playlist in a CSV file.
  • Plays downloaded songs using the playsound library.

Notes

  • The script requires a stable internet connection to search and download songs from YouTube.
  • Ensure that you have sufficient disk space for storing downloaded music files.
